Beyond the Surface Add on Module 3 - Indentation and Scratch Applications
Gain Industry-specific application knowledge by exploring the diverse applications of indentation and scratch testing techniques across various industries. This four-part series delves into the testing of battery materials, focusing on mechanical properties that enhance durability and efficiency, and the evaluation of medical materials and devices, with a special emphasis on soft materials like stent coatings and contact lenses. Additionally, it covers the performance testing of automotive and aerospace components, highlighting functional coatings such as TiN and the mar resistance of paints. The series also investigates soft materials, including paints, soft polymers, and bio-materials, providing deeper insights through advanced instrumented characterization techniques.
March 4, 2025: Battery Materials
This webinar highlights the critical role of mechanical property testing in evaluating the performance and reliability of battery materials, offering real-world examples from various stages of the manufacturing process. Key topics include the durability of electrode coatings, a crucial factor for long-term battery performance, the analysis of particle fracture to ensure structural integrity, and the evaluation of surface property variation, which can impact battery efficiency.
By the end of this webinar, participants will understand how mechanical testing can optimize battery materials and improve overall product quality.
March 18, 2025: Medical Devices
This webinar presents key examples illustrating the importance of mechanical properties in the design and performance of medical materials and devices, with a particular emphasis on soft materials and small-scale devices. Topics include the mechanical behavior of stent coatings, essential for durability and effectiveness in vascular treatments, tooth enamel treatments for enhancing dental health, and the mechanical optimization of contact lenses to ensure comfort and functionality.
By the end of this webinar, participants will gain valuable insights into how mechanical testing contributes to the development and success of medical innovations.
April 1, 2025: Automotive and aerospace
This webinar focuses on the critical testing of automotive and aerospace components, with an emphasis on evaluating the performance of functional coatings used in these industries. Participants will explore the mechanical behavior of hard protective coatings such as TiN, the mar resistance of paints, and the adhesion of optical coatings critical for both durability and performance. Additionally, we will cover high-temperature testing, essential for ensuring the reliability of materials in extreme environments.
By the end of this webinar, attendees will have a comprehensive understanding of the testing methods used to validate the performance of coatings in automotive and aerospace applications.
April 15, 2025: Soft Materials
This module delves into the unique challenges of testing soft materials and explores how instrumented characterization techniques provide deeper insights into their mechanical behavior. Topics include the analysis of paints and varnishes for their flexibility and durability, the testing of soft polymers used in a variety of industries, and the evaluation of bio-materials, which play a crucial role in medical and biological applications.
By the end of this webinar, participants will understand how advanced testing methods can accurately assess the properties of soft materials, enabling improved performance and reliability.
